php订单系统怎么做
-
php订单系统是一种用于管理订单信息的系统,可以帮助企业提高订单管理效率和准确性。下面将介绍php订单系统的主要功能和实现方法。
一、主要功能
1. 订单录入:php订单系统可以提供一个用户友好的界面,方便用户输入订单信息。用户可以输入客户信息、商品信息、数量、价格等相关信息,并可以选择支付方式等。2. 订单查询:php订单系统可以提供强大的查询功能,用户可以通过订单号、客户名称、订单日期等条件进行查询,并可以实现多种条件的组合查询。系统可以快速的返回查询结果。
3. 订单统计:php订单系统可以根据订单信息进行统计分析,包括订单数量、订单金额、销售额等。通过这些统计数据,企业可以了解订单的发展趋势,及时调整销售策略。
4. 订单管理:php订单系统可以实现对订单的管理,包括订单的修改、删除、审核等操作。管理员可以对订单进行权限控制,确保订单信息的安全性和准确性。
5. 订单跟踪:php订单系统可以提供订单追踪功能,用户可以随时了解订单的状态,包括订单是否已发货、是否已付款等。
6. 库存管理:php订单系统可以与库存管理系统进行集成,实现订单与库存的实时同步,确保订单的准确性。
二、实现方法
1. 数据库设计:首先,需要设计数据库表来存储订单信息。可以设计订单表、客户表、商品表等。通过合理的数据库设计,可以提高系统的性能和扩展性。2. 前端开发:使用php的模板引擎技术,可以实现订单录入界面、查询界面等。通过模板引擎,可以方便的实现动态页面和数据的展示。
3. 后端开发:使用php的面向对象编程技术,可以实现订单管理功能。可以使用php的框架来简化开发工作,例如Laravel、Yii等。
4. 数据库操作:使用php的数据库操作技术,可以实现对数据库的增删改查操作。可以使用PDO、MySQLi等技术。
5. 权限控制:使用php的权限控制技术,可以实现对订单管理的权限控制,确保订单信息的安全性。
总结:通过以上的方法,可以实现一个功能完善的php订单系统。企业可以根据自己的实际需求,进行系统的定制和优化,以满足订单管理的要求。同时,对于php订单系统的开发和维护,也需要专业的人员进行管理,以确保系统的稳定性和可靠性。
2年前 -
建立一个PHP订单系统需要考虑以下几个方面:
1. 数据库设计:
首先要搭建一个合适的数据库结构,包括订单表、商品表、客户表等等。订单表需要包含订单编号、客户信息、商品信息、订单状态等字段,以方便对订单进行管理和查询。2. 用户管理:
为了实现用户系统,需要添加用户注册、登录、个人信息管理等功能。用户注册时需要验证邮箱或手机号码的有效性,并进行密码加密储存;用户登录需要验证输入的用户名和密码是否匹配。3. 商品管理:
商品管理是系统的核心功能之一,需要实现商品的增删改查。管理员能管理商品的属性,如库存数量、价格、是否上架等。用户可以在系统中浏览商品并添加到购物车中。4. 购物车:
购物车是订单系统中非常重要的一部分,它用于存储用户选择的商品和数量。用户可以添加商品到购物车中,并在结算时确认订单。购物车功能需要实现添加、修改、删除商品和更新商品总价等功能。5. 订单管理:
订单管理需要实现订单的生成、支付、发货、退款等功能。用户下单后,订单会生成并进入待支付状态,用户完成支付后订单状态变为已支付。在商品发货后,订单状态变为配送中,并更新物流信息。用户可以申请退款,管理员审核通过后,订单状态变为已退款等。除了以上的基本功能,还可以根据需求添加更多功能,如优惠券、评价系统、物流追踪、站内消息等。建立一个PHP订单系统需要综合考虑设计、开发、安全性和用户体验等因素,在不断迭代和优化的基础上,构建一个高效可靠的订单系统。
2年前 -
PHP订单系统可以通过以下方法和操作流程来实现:
1. 需求分析
– 确定订单系统的功能和需求,包括订单创建、浏览、编辑、删除等操作。
– 确定订单数据的结构,如订单号、商品信息、客户信息等。2. 数据库设计
– 创建订单数据库表,包括订单表、商品表和客户表等。
– 设置表之间的关联关系,如订单表和商品表的关联。3. 前端界面设计
– 设计订单系统的前端界面,包括订单列表页面、订单详情页面等。
– 使用HTML和CSS来进行界面布局和美化。4. 后端代码编写
– 创建PHP文件,包括订单处理、数据库连接和数据处理等。
– 编写订单类,包括订单的增删改查等方法。
– 编写数据库类,包括数据库连接和数据读写等方法。
– 编写客户类和商品类,封装相关操作方法。5. 订单列表页面
– 通过PHP从数据库中读取订单数据。
– 使用HTML和PHP动态生成订单列表,包括订单号、商品信息和客户信息等。
– 提供订单编辑和删除功能,通过表单提交或AJAX请求实现。6. 订单详情页面
– 根据用户点击的订单号,从数据库中读取对应订单的详情数据。
– 使用HTML和PHP动态生成订单详情页面,展示订单的详细信息。7. 订单创建页面
– 创建订单时,需要填写商品信息和客户信息。
– 使用HTML和PHP实现表单提交,将数据写入数据库。8. 订单编辑和删除功能
– 点击订单列表页面的编辑按钮,跳转至订单编辑页面。
– 在订单编辑页面,使用表单填充订单数据,并通过提交操作更新到数据库。
– 点击订单列表页面的删除按钮,通过AJAX请求或表单提交删除数据库中的订单数据。9. 其他功能扩展
– 可以添加权限验证功能,限制只有管理员或特定用户可以操作订单。
– 可以添加订单状态管理功能,例如确认订单、发货、完成等。
– 可以添加订单搜索、排序和分页等功能,方便用户查找和管理订单。以上是一个基本的PHP订单系统的实现思路和操作流程,根据具体的需求和设计,可以进行相应的调整和扩展。
2年前